What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Mixed-breed dogs are highly adaptable and thrive in a variety of environments, from apartments to homes with large yards. They are best suited to loving households that can give them plenty of attention, exercise, and enrichment.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Mixed-breed dogs, especially those with energy, benefit from regular outdoor activity. A secure yard or daily walks and playtime in parks will help them stay healthy and happy.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Most mixed-breed dogs are wonderful family pets and tend to get along well with children, especially if they are socialized from a young age. Always supervise interactions with younger children and teach them to respect the dog’s space.
